Reconfiguring SWAP partition
 
When installing fedora 7 I make by mistake a huge SWAP partition of 20 GB. I want now to split it in 2: one of 500 MB (I hope it would be enough) and the rest for the data. Can anybody tell me how to do this ? I must mention that I am not soch a good expert in fdisk and others. It wold be a possibility to reuse the installation disk and try to reapir option ? It would that be posiible to do without losing the data in the other fedora partition ?
The boot partition is sda 5 and the swap partition is sda 6. I also have win partitions (sda 7 to 10) that I need for the WIN XP, also installed.

Use gparted to resize your swap partition and then to resize your fedora installation partition
